The Invincible, expected on PC and consoles, shows itself for the first time with impressive gameplay


The Poles from Starward Industries reveal to us today in the PC Gaming Show, the very first gameplay footage for their upcoming game in 2023, The Invincible. In this first-person adventure thriller, you must uncover the mystery of Regis III, the hostile planet in the Lyra galaxy where your crew disappeared.

This narrative epic is inspired by the eponymous novel written by science fiction author Stanislaw Lem in the 1960s and will feature Yasnaan astrobiologist who wakes up on this uninhabited and unexplored earth, and who will have to make choices to save his skin and that of his teams.

During this long sequence of gameplay in a very impressive retro-futuristic style, we discover a conversation between Yasna and Novik, who must be one of her colleagues, who guides her from a distance. Yasna finds herself in a barren area that she can investigate to uncover its secrets and update her map of the world.

She then integrates her own robot in which she moves more heavily until she comes across another robot from which she is hiding. At the end of the sequence, Yasna finds herself in danger because she is being targeted by an Antimat, a large robot with several legs…

The publication of this gameplay trailer is also an opportunity for Starward Industries to announce the entry into its capital of 11 bit studios on a minority basis as well as the edition of The Invincible by these. 11 bit studios are also at work in The Altersalso announced during the PC Gaming Show.

We still don’t have a specific release date for The Invincible. The game will be released in 2023 on PC and consoles, without further details, although we suspect that the game is 100% current consoles. You can already add the game to your Steam Wishlist.
